I made 2 new disks, which are both 60cm but have an axle about the length of half an iron spike for each side. It works well for drums. I also made some more spikes.

I think this thing below is the most useful thing I've ever made actually. I made the height slider taller to be more accurate, and I also added some marks that indicate the minimum height requirements for certain components. Sadly, it only works at resolutions of 1024x768 or higher.
I'll probably release this tool soon, but first, what other component heights should I add? And should I make it compatible with smaller resolutions?

The height guide in my sig is based on a similar idea to your latter mod. I overcame the multiple resolution issue by creating a separate image that would get positioned and resized to match the slider. Starcore V4 was also suppose to include my list of component heights (according to my height guide) but it never got released and I misplaced my copy of it. I have my original list of all the stock component heights for each AP but I'd have to clean if up if I ever decided to release it again.
